For this reason, APPTHI held a series of conferences in 3 cities to discuss and make it a meeting place for world law experts with law lecturers throughout Indonesia and invited lecturers from various countries, such as South Korea, India, Malaysia and Europe to take a part in this conference. The 1st APPTHI International Conference on Changing of Law (the series) is the first international conference series held in Indonesia by the Association of Indonesian Law College Leaders (APPTHI), inviting several legal experts from countries such as the USA, the Netherlands, Korea, Malaysia, India, as well as South Korea. This activity has 3 major themes each held in several cities, namely: in Jakarta which will be held at Trisakti University on 22 July 2023 with the theme Changing of Law in the digital era, while in Makassar it will take place at the Indonesian Muslim University/UMI) on July 24 2023 with the theme Changing of Law in the Energy sector and Natural Resources Management, as well as the last series of conferences in Bali on July 26 2023 at Warmadewa University, becoming a series of academic activities that have a broad spectrum and dimension of legal knowledge with various legal perspectives such as business law, corporate law, civil law, criminal law, intellectual property law, telematics law, agrarian law, environmental law, HTN/HAN etc. This event was carried out within the framework of the first round of the APPTHI international program which will continue to be held regularly every year. This program is also a form of implementation of various forms of international cooperation in several countries such as New York University, Utrecht University, National University of Malaysia, Hankuk University, and Jawaharlal Nehru University. In this event APPTHI collaborated with the international program organizer, PASQAPRO. For the activities of The First APPTHI International Conference on Changing Law, The Series, involving campuses as co-hosts in Jakarta (hosted by Trisakti University), including: Jakarta Islamic University, Universitas Suryakancana, cianjur, Lampung Mitra University, Palembang Law School STIHPADA, Islamic University Jakarta, Muhamadiyah University Jakarta, YARSI University, National University, Borobudur University, while co-hosted in Makassar (Host Indonesian Muslim University): Panca Bakti University, West Kalimantan, Sawerigading University, Christian University of Paulus, Makasar, Universitas Juanda, Bogor and Seventeen August University (UNTAG) Semarang, for Bali with the host university Warmadewa, assisted by co-hosts including: Caritas College of Law, Papua. Although there has been an increasing interest in rural tourism in terms of research, training and teaching in recent years, its conceptualization and the relationships between concept and strategy are still poorly represented and not well understood. The need for such a critical understanding is particularly crucial as rural areas experience rapid change, and as tourism is viewed as a key element of development and regeneration. This volume provides an interdisciplinary approach to new directions in rural tourism, drawing on the latest conceptual thinking and evolving strategic roles. It brings together case study exemplification from the UK, Denmark, Norway, Austria, Spain, Slovenia, Poland, New Zealand and the Caribbean. It debates such key issues as sustainability and niche marketing. The book thus provides accessible material drawn from a range of environmental and cultural contexts and focuses attention on the nature and interrelationships between local and global issues in rural tourism and development.

This book focuses on cultural tourism as it develops into the second decade of the new millennium. It presents recent hospitality and tourism research findings from various sources, including academic researchers and scholars, industry professionals, government and quasi-government officials, and other key industry practitioners. It discusses the latest tourism industry trends and identifies gaps in the research from a pragmatic and applied perspective. It includes specific chapters on innovation in tourism, the virtual visitor, cross-cultural visions of digital collections, heritage and museum management in the digital era, cultural and digital tourism policy, marketing and governance, social media, emerging technologies and e-tourism and many other topics of contemporary significance in global hospitality and tourism. The book is edited in collaboration with the International Association of Cultural and Digital Tourism (IACuDiT) and includes the proceedings of the Second International Conference on Cultural and Digital Tourism.
